A remarkable event is on the horizon. The Black Empowerment & Community Council is proud to announce the Inaugural Vanguard Awards Luncheon, a prestigious occasion dedicated to recognizing and celebrating the unsung heroes among us—those individuals whose extraordinary efforts have significantly contributed to the empowerment and upliftment of our community. Set against the backdrop of the Kissimmee Civic Center on June 20th, this event promises to be a memorable celebration of leadership, innovation, and community spirit.

Special Awardees Leading the Way


Among the distinguished honorees are individuals whose names have become synonymous with progress and positive change within Osceola County. Deloris McMillon, recipient of the Vanguard Legacy Award, has been a steadfast advocate for civil rights, her leadership earning her the NAACP's Lifetime Achievement Award. Christiana Morris, celebrated for her role in spurring economic growth as the Economic Development Director for Osceola County, has paved the way for new opportunities and prosperity. Justin Cloud, through his passion and commitment as the Executive Director and Founder of The Cloud Family Foundation, has made significant strides in youth development and community service.

These special awardees, among others, exemplify the essence of the Vanguard Awards—individuals whose actions and achievements resonate far beyond the confines of a single event, inspiring a legacy of continued community engagement and empowerment.
